We are looking to recruit an number of enthusiastic candidates for our client, who is looking for reliable Production Operatives. Vancancies arise with short notice, this is on a temporary basis, but may be longer term for suitable candidates. Starting off on £11.44 increasing to £12.60 after 12 weeks. Strict dress and hygiene regulations relate to this role, therefore, you will be invited to our office to complete pre employement selection. Working hours – Monday – Thursday 5pm – 10pm. Own Safety boots needed all other PPE will be provided. Duties: – Ensure the production schedules and targets are met. – Monitor production processes to ensure efficiency and quality, Right 1st time product inspection and packing. – Responsible for the inspection and final packing of the lines daily production. – Operate all production line machinery in a safe and efficient manner. – Maintain GMP standards, policies and practices as defined in the standard Operating procedures. – Record all component information when used on relevant forms. Skills: – Similar previous experience. – Attention to detail and ability to follow instructions -Flexible – Ability to work in a fast-paced environment – Effective communication skills to collaborate with team members For the purpose of the Conduct Regulations 2003, when advertising permanent vacancies we are acting as an Employment Agency, and when advertising temporary/contract vacancies we are acting as an Employment Business
